Executive Summary
Company: ArchForge AI
Self-reported basis: The description is entirely self-reported and unverified, based on a single submission to the OpenAI 2026 hackathon on Devpost. No additional evidence of traction, revenue, customers or adoption is provided.
What it appears to be: A tool that uses AI to generate cloud architecture from user ideas, intended for rapid deployment in minutes. The author describes it as a platform for generating deployable cloud architecture using AI.
What changed: This is a hackathon submission with no evidence of prior development or commercial activity. It is unclear whether this represents an early-stage prototype, a proof-of-concept, or a nascent product.
Single most important open question: Is there any evidence of actual usage, customer feedback, or technical progress beyond the hackathon submission?

Diligence Questions To Ask The Founders
- What is the exact process by which an idea becomes cloud architecture in your tool?
- How does your AI system determine what architecture to generate from a user input?
- Have you tested this with real users or customers? If so, what feedback have you received?
- What are the technical limitations of your current implementation?
- Is this intended as a standalone product or part of a larger platform?
- What is your plan for monetization and customer acquisition?
- How do you intend to scale beyond a single developer?
